The same hard drives being displayed multiple times also occurs on my computers. I have three external hard drives formatted in Ext3. Sometimes they will be displayed twice, which is shown in the attached picture. If a drive is unmounted, one shortcut will remain and the other will go away. This can usually be fixed by unplugging all the hard drives and restarting the computer. The two shortcuts to the same hard drive aren't exactly the same. One, the "real" one, has an option to eject, while the other has an option to unmount the volume.
